Product Introduction

Overview

The MC74ACT04DTR2G is a high-performance silicon-gate CMOS hex inverter produced by onsemi. This device is part of the 74ACT series, which is known for its compatibility with TTL (Transistor-Transistor Logic) inputs. The MC74ACT04DTR2G is packaged in a 14-lead TSSOP (Thin Shrink Small Outline Package) and is lead-free, making it suitable for a wide range of modern electronic applications.

This component is designed to operate within a supply voltage range of 4.5 to 5.5 volts, making it versatile for various digital circuit designs. It features low power consumption and high output drive capability, making it an excellent choice for applications requiring reliable and efficient logic operations.

Key Specifications

Parameter Value Unit Conditions
VCC (Supply Voltage) 4.5 to 5.5 V
VI (DC Input Voltage) 0 to VCC V
VO (DC Output Voltage) 0 to VCC V
IOH (Output Current - High) -24 mA
IOL (Output Current - Low) 24 mA
VIH (Minimum High Level Input Voltage) 2.0 V VCC = 4.5V or 5.5V
VIL (Maximum Low Level Input Voltage) 0.8 V VCC = 4.5V or 5.5V
VOH (Minimum High Level Output Voltage) 4.4 to 5.4 V IOUT = -50 μA
VOL (Maximum Low Level Output Voltage) 0.1 V IOUT = 50 μA
tPLH (Propagation Delay) 1.5 to 9.0 ns CL = 50 pF, VCC = 5.0V
tPHL (Propagation Delay) 1.5 to 8.5 ns CL = 50 pF, VCC = 5.0V
TJ (Junction Temperature) -150 to 150 °C
TA (Operating Ambient Temperature Range) -40 to 85 °C

Key Features

  • TTL Compatible Inputs: The MC74ACT04DTR2G has inputs that are compatible with TTL logic levels, making it easy to integrate into systems using TTL logic.
  • High Output Drive Capability: The device can source or sink up to 24 mA, which is sufficient for driving multiple TTL loads.
  • Low Power Consumption: The component operates with low quiescent supply current, making it energy-efficient.
  • Wide Operating Temperature Range: It can operate over a temperature range of -40°C to 85°C, making it suitable for various environmental conditions.
  • Lead-Free Packaging: The TSSOP-14 package is lead-free, complying with modern environmental regulations.
  • High Speed Operation: The device has propagation delays as low as 1.5 ns, ensuring fast logic operations.
